Historical Events Happened In 1534

Tuesday, 21 May 2013

Jan 24 On this day in history françois I signs classified treaty with evangelical German monarchy

Jan 24 Francois I signs classified treaty with evangelical German monarchy on this day in history.

Feb 26 Pope Paul II affirms George van Egmond as bishop of Utrecht on this day in history.

Mar 23 On this day in history aragonese legal code formally recognised

Mar 26 On this day in history lübeck accept free Dutch ships into East Sea

Mar 26 Lubeck accept free Dutch ships into East Sea on this day in history.

Apr 07 Jose de Anchieta, Spanish jesuit/missionary (Brazilian Tupi-Indians) on this day in history.

Apr 17 On this day in history sir Thomas More confined in London Tower

Apr 20 Elizabeth Barton, [St Magd van Kent], British prophet, dies on this day in history.

May 10 On this day in history french navigator Jacques Cartier reaches Newfoundland

May 10 On this day in history off Cape Bonavista Newfoundland Jacques Cartier 1491-1557 sights Cape Bonavista after three week crossing from France; stopped ten days by ice; then skirts east coast of Newfoundland; his first voyage to Canada

May 12 Württemberg becomes Lutheran on this day in history.

May 12 On this day in history wurttemberg becomes Lutherian

May 28 Dirk Martens, Flemish printer/humanist, dies at about 83 on this day in history.

Jun 09 Jacques Cartier 1st sails into mouth of St Lawrence River on this day in history.

Jun 09 Jacques Cartier first sails into mouth of St Lawrence River on this day in history.

Jun 12 On this day in history turkish adm Chaireddin "Barbarossa" allows Giulia Gonzaga to kidnap & plunder Naples

Jun 29 Jacques Cartier discovers Prince Edward Islands Canada on this day in history.

Jul 01 On this day in history frederik II, King of Denmark/Norway (1559-88)

Jul 04 Christian III is elected King of Denmark and Norway in the town of Rye on this day in history.

Jul 07 European colonization of the Americas: first known exchange between Europeans and natives of the Gulf of St. Lawrence, in New Brunswick on this day in history.

Jul 18 On this day in history zacharias Ursinus, German theologist (Heidelberger Catechism)

Jul 19 On this day in history willem van Enkenvoirt, cardinal/bishop of Utrecht, dies at about 70

Jul 24 Jacques Cartier, lands in Canada, claims it for France on this day in history.

Aug 15 Ignatius of Loyola forms society of Jesus/Jesuits on this day in history.

Aug 20 Turkish admiral Chaireddin"Barbarossa" occupies Tunis on this day in history.

Sep 25 On this day in history clement VII, [Giulio de' Medici], Italian Pope (1523-34), dies at 56

Oct 13 Alessandro Farnese elected as Pope Paul III on this day in history.

Oct 18 On this day in history new pursuit of French protestants

Oct 26 On this day in history charles V names Joris of Egmont, bishop of Utrecht

Oct 30 On this day in history english Parliament passes Act of Supremacy, making King Henry VIII head of the English church

Nov 03 English parliament accepts Act of Supremacy: Henry VIII church leader on this day in history.

Nov 05 Joachim Camerarius, German botanist/physician (horticulture catalog) on this day in history.

Nov 06 -7] Zealand hit by heavy storm on this day in history.

Famous Birthdays In 1534

Famous People Born In This Year In History

Feb 05 Giovanni de' Bardi, Italian writer (d. 1612) was born on this day in history.

Apr 07 Jose de Anchieta, Spanish jesuit/missionary (Brazilian Tupi-Indians) was born on this day in history.

Jun 23 On this day in history birth of oda Nobunaga, Japanese warlord (d. 1582)

Jul 01 Frederik II, King of Denmark/Norway (1559-88) was born on this day in history.

Jul 01 Frederick II of Denmark (d. 1588) was born on this day in history.

Jul 18 On this day in history birth of zacharias Ursinus, German theologist (Heidelberger Catechism)

Sep 24 Guru Ram Das, fourth Sikh Guru (d. 1581) was born on this day in history.

Nov 05 On this day in history birth of joachim Camerarius, German botanist/physician (horticulture catalog)

Famous Deaths In 1534

Famous People Died In This Year In History

Mar 05 Antonio da Correggio, Italian painter (b. 1489) died on this day in history.

Apr 20 Elizabeth Barton, [St Magd van Kent], British prophet, dies on this day in history.

May 28 Dirk Martens, Flemish printer/humanist, dies at about 83 on this day in history.

Jul 19 Willem van Enkenvoirt, cardinal/bishop of Utrecht, dies at about 70 on this day in history.

Aug 09 On this day in history death of cardinal Cajetan, Italian theologian (b. 1470)

Sep 25 On this day in history clement VII, [Giulio de' Medici], Italian Pope (1523-34), dies at 56
